The HVAC/R Technician Program at FutureTrades prepares students to install, maintain, and repair residential and commercial heating, ventilation, air conditioning, and refrigeration systems. This in-demand field offers excellent job prospects, stability, and career growth.
Program Length: 6 months
Certifications: EPA Section 608 Certification, OSHA 10
Training Format: Hands-on + Classroom instruction
Fundamentals of HVAC systems
Electricity and electrical controls
Refrigeration cycle and components
System diagnostics and repair
Safety procedures and regulations
Customer service and workplace professionalism
